Correct Answer - Relation (ii) is wrong
`K.E. = (1)/(2)mv^2 = M(LT^(-1))^2 = [ML^2T^(-2)]`
`Now, (1)/(16)m v^2 = M(LT^(-1))^2 = [ML^2T^(-2)]`
:. This formula is dimensionally correct for K.E.
(ii) `(1)/(2)m upsilon +ma = M(LT^(-1))^2 +MLT^(-2)`
This is not permissibal as quantities with
different dimension cannot be added.
Hence Relation(ii) is wrong.
